From the 2028 to 2029 academic year, higher education (HE) providers delivering courses through franchise arrangements will need to be registered with the Office for Students if they have 300 or more franchised students.

This guidance is for HE providers that are delivering any course at level 4 or above, including postgraduate courses (level 7 and above). It does not apply to apprenticeships, or students studying for modules or credits only.

It should be read alongside the government’s response to the consultation on strengthening oversight of HE partnership delivery: Franchising in higher education.
